**The Role**

As a Technical Specialist, you will be part of a team that is working to deliver airspace modernisation, a key initiative that aims to improve the efficiency, safety, and sustainability of air traffic operations. You will be responsible for conducting research, analysis, and modelling of airspace scenarios, developing, and testing technical specifications and standards, and providing technical support and guidance to the Airspace Modernisation Delivery Team and stakeholders. You will play a part in engaging with external suppliers and stakeholders.

This is a hands-on position which will rely on you having excellent communication, collaboration, and problem-solving skills, as well as a high level of accuracy and attention to detail.

You will support the technical development of policies on the use of Electronic Conspicuity (EC) devices in UK Airspace ensuring the project deliverables are technically sound, achievable, and implementable. You will provide technical assurance and guidance to the rest of the Delivery Team and external stakeholders as required. You will engage with the wider CAA to ensure that internal stakeholders’ needs are met by the studies and strategic direction of the Airspace Modernisation Delivery Team

**Desirable**
- Understand the operation of modern surveillance technologies, in particular, the range of Electronic Conspicuity devices in use in the UK today.
- Have an understanding of key legislative factors influencing and determining the CAA’s role as an airspace regulator e.g. the Civil Aviation Act, Air Navigation Order, Rules of the Air Regulations, European legislation, EUROCONTROL Convention and Permanent Commission Directives, and the appropriate MAA Regulatory Publications.
- Have knowledge of the UK Airspace Modernisation Strategy (AMS)
